logo

Output f34091a6e751940589f6ffa6807613ec4dfa7cc8435fac74c9dbe689c3c46aba:1

value
22834938
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 32c5574512da22b52e5e1594790d753a70a69444 OP_EQUALVERIFY OP_CHECKSIG
address
15dTC5Vd4Zpn55r6avFuJcDkoGABdC4tMy
transaction
f34091a6e751940589f6ffa6807613ec4dfa7cc8435fac74c9dbe689c3c46aba